Output 58159f8eddf673bae244b658ff67860867ae2fa70963d7f419aafd6430351f0e:0

value
2654018529
script pubkey
OP_0 OP_PUSHBYTES_20 1dfac3079e6d91de8099e9fbc2f635ac7bc590f7
address
ltc1qrhavxpu7dkgaaqyea8au9a3443auty8ha9408f
transaction
58159f8eddf673bae244b658ff67860867ae2fa70963d7f419aafd6430351f0e
spent
true